NOVELTY - A graphene-tin dioxide composite material preparing method involves dispersing 150-200 pts. vol. solvent uniformly in 0.3-0.5 mass parts graphene oxide and adding 1-1.5 mass parts tin dichloride and 0.4-0.6 mass parts sodium dodecyl benzene sulfonate for carrying out reaction at room temperature of 20-25 degrees C or 30-80 degrees C for 2-12 hours to obtain a dispersed product. The dispersed product is dried and calcined at 500-600 degrees C for 4-6 hours in an inert atmosphere to obtain the finished product. USE - Method for preparing graphene-tin dioxide composite material for use in energy storage (claimed).
